    Trustworthiness is the foundation of any successful supplier-customer relationship. A trustworthy supplier is transparent about their products' origin, quality standards, and supply chain processes. They should provide certifications and documentation to affirm that their electrodes comply with international standards, such as DIN, AWS, or ISO. Furthermore, a reliable supplier will support their clients with after-sales services, including technical support and return policies.
